_______________________________________________________ About Lori López, BA, M.Ed Lori López, a native Texan, is multi degreed, receiving her Associate of Arts from Tarrant County Junior College, earned a Bachelor of Arts in Sociology from Texas Christian University and a Master of Education degree in Educational Technology. After graduating from TCU, she became a teacher through an alternative certification program offered through Tarleton State University. In 2002, she began teaching for the Fort Worth Independent School District. From 2002 to 2008, Lori focused her energies on helping children of all ages learn to read in preparation for outside world applications and also for the Texas Assessment of Knowledge and Skills, or the TAKS test. Lori is currently serving the Fort Worth ISD as a Educational Technology Campus Specialist. She oversees 13 campuses, 13 technology integration educators, and 485 teachers. She is instrumental in training teachers to integrate technology in everday classroom use, including instruction and presentation.
